When does 'Taste the Nation With Padma Lakshmi' Season 2 release?

'Taste the Nation with Padma Lakshmi' is scheduled to premiere on May 5, 2023. 

How can I watch 'Taste the Nation With Padma Lakshmi' Season 2?

You can watch 'Taste the Nation With Padma Lakshmi' Season 2 on Hulu. 

Who is the host of 'Taste the Nation With Padma Lakshmi' Season 2?

Padma Lakshmi, the host of 'Taste the Nation,' is a multi-talented producer, actress, model, and writer who has made a name for herself in the entertainment industry. She was born in India and moved to the United States when she was just four years old. Her diverse background and experiences have helped shape her passion for food and the role it plays in bringing people together. Lakshmi's impressive career includes roles in various TV shows, movies, and modeling campaigns. She is perhaps best known for her appearances on 'Star Trek: Enterprise' (2001), 'Glitter' (2001), and 'The Ten Commandments' (2006). Lakshmi also made history in 2007 as the first Indian woman to be a guest and co-host on the popular TV show 'The View'.

In addition to her on-screen appearances, Padma has also made her mark in the culinary world. She appeared with Rocco DiSpirito on an episode of 'Top Chef' (2006), which eventually led to her becoming the host of the show. Her deep knowledge of food and her ability to connect with people from all walks of life made her the perfect fit for the role. Outside of her professional life, Padma has also made headlines for her personal life. She has a 10-year-old daughter with Adam Dell, the brother of Dell Computer founder Michael Dell. She was also previously married to the acclaimed author Salman Rushdie. What is 'Taste the Nation With Padma Lakshmi' Season 2 all about?

Padma, the celebrated cookbook author, host, and executive producer, is set to take audiences on a truly immersive culinary journey through her latest show 'Taste the Nation'. This show promises to showcase the rich and diverse food culture of various immigrant groups that have heavily shaped what American food is today. In her quest to uncover the roots and relationships between food, humanity, and history, Padma's journey will take her through indigenous communities to recent immigrant arrivals. Along the way, she will break bread with Americans across the nation, seeking out their stories, recipes, and cultural histories that are often overlooked. In fact, 'Taste the Nation' is more than just a food show. It is a celebration of the people who have contributed to America's unique culinary landscape.

Through her interactions with chefs, restaurateurs, and home cooks, Padma hopes to challenge notions of identity, belonging, and what it means to be American. The show is hosted and produced by Padma herself, who is known for her expert knowledge of the culinary world. She is joined by Sarina Roma and David Shadrack Smith, who will serve as directors for the series.
